PermittedP/2024/1112Submitted 2 years agoBasement

486 Bath Road Hounslow TW5 9UP

Non-material amendments to change the wording of conditions 3 (extenal materials), 4 (soft & hard landscaping), 6 (waste storage), 7 (boundary treatment), 18 (building envelope) and 27 (external noise) so that they effectively "do not bite" until above ground works occur following planning permission 00083/486/P15 dated 24/06/2021 for the demolition of the existing buildings and redevelopment of the site to provide 21 residential units (C3) within a part three, part four and part set back six storey, building with associated amenity space, landscaping, basement car parking and all associated works.
